Union Affiliate Invites Public to Post Healthcare "Horror" Stories on Web Site

An AFL-CIO affiliate has launched a web site to “unmask the real players behind our nation’s broken healthcare system and to bring healthcare consumers together as a powerful force for change,” according to a statement by the labor union. Visitors to the Health Care Hustle site at www.workingamerica.org/healthcarehustle/ are invited to “vent online about their own healthcare horror stories” through April. They are also urged to send a message to the special interest they hold most responsible “for the sorry state of the system: Big Pharma, the Insurance Industry, Greedy Corporations, or Bush & Co.” Working America, the community affiliate of the AFL-CIO for workers who do not have a union, will tally the messages, with each message counting as one vote, and will target the winner in a campaign intended to get “powerful interests who don’t want to pay their fair share for real reform” to change their ways.
